Introduction

After much discussion (and dick jokes) we arranged a tasting of blind sparkling wines at Matt and Ori's house. Dinner was prepared and served, and the wines started to flow shortly after. The wines were served with brut wines first, then rose's. All bottles were blinded in brown bags and we were allowed to pour for ourselves. (making some decisions easier due to bottle shape)

  • 1999 Alfred Gratien Champagne Brut Millésimé 93 Points

    France, Champagne

    Smells juicy and delicious. The palate is big and very much to my liking. Sweet cake, fresh apples, frosting, crushed sweet tart candy. Long finish. This is one of those big, rich Champagnes that can be somewhat polorizing for people. I prefer this style and really, really enjoyed this. Tasted blind, guessed Champagne.

  • 2002 Pierre Péters Champagne Grand Cru Cuvée Speciale Blanc de Blancs Les Chetillons 92 Points

    France, Champagne, Champagne Grand Cru

    Smells awesome, aromas of limes, cake frosting, bread, and mineral show in the glass. Shows just as delicious on the palate, fresh apples and limes, lots of citrus with richness showing the entire time but just in the background. Great acidity and feel, long finish. This is some great stuff. Tasted blind, guessed Champagne. Ranked 1st place in the tasting.

Closing

Once everyone had completed the tasting we had all participants write down their three favorite bottles with 3 points given for a 1st place, 2 points given for a 2nd place, and 1 point given for a 3rd place.

The winning bottle with 13 points was the 2002 Pierre Péters Champagne Blanc de Blancs Brut Cuvée Spéciale.

There was a tie for second place with 12 points being given to both the N.V. Gloria Ferrer Sonoma Brut[ (LOL!) and the N.V. L. Aubry Fils Champagne Brut 1er Cru.

Down a huge margin with 4 points there was also a tie for third place between the 1999 Alfred Gratien Champagne Brut Millésimé and the 2008 Argyle Brut Rosé.

With 2 points each were the N.V. Philippe Prié Champagne Brut Tradition, N.V. Clotilde Davenne Crémant de Bourgogne Extra Brut, N.V. Capitello Wines Brut Willamette Valley, N.V. Kirkland Signature Champagne Brut. Any wines not listed scored no points.
